Chapel Street is in Levenshulme, Manchester and in Manchester district. M19 3GH is located in the Levenshulme elect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Manchester, Gorton.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Safety

Is Chapel Street dangerous?

In 2023, 10 crimes were reported near Chapel Street . 82% of streets in the UK are more dangerous. This street can be considered very safe. The most common type of crime was violence and sexual offences. Crime rate was measured within a 0.5 mile radius of M19 3GH.
